BLE Saves Batteries for Mileage Tracker App

BLE Saves Batteries for Mileage Tracker App

Motus has developed a beacon that, when placed in a user’s car, can automatically turn a smartphone’s GPS data on or off to help save batteries while tracking mileage throughout the workday.

Study Forecasts 350 Percent Rise in IoT in Retail by 2021

According to a Juniper Research study, this growth is being fueled by RFID and Bluetooth Low Energy beacons, which are becoming lower in cost and more prevalent in stores, and which can now be leveraged for better analytics, customer experience and supply chain improvements.
